Job Summary:

We are looking for a passionate and experienced Retail Manager/ Merchandise Manager to lead the operations of our client's store, combining books, lifestyle products, and a café experience. This role focuses on delivering excellent customer service, driving sales, managing inventory, and ensuring store operations meet Japanese retail standards.

Main Responsibilities:

Operations & Store Presentation

  • Oversee daily operations across bookstore, lifestyle retail, and café areas
  • Ensure store cleanliness, organization, and visual merchandising are up to standard
  • Work with the merchandising team to manage inventory and stock replenishment
  • Maintain security and loss prevention measures

Sales & Financials

  • Drive sales and achieve monthly targets

  • Develop and implement promotional activities and displays

  • Handle daily sales reporting, cash handling, and basic financial analysis

  • Track sales trends and suggest strategies to improve performance

Team Management

  • Recruit, train, schedule, and supervise retail and café staff
  • Foster a positive and service-oriented team environment
  • Conduct performance reviews and ensure training on service standards and product knowledge

Customer Experience

  • Ensure high standards of customer service across all areas
  • Resolve customer complaints effectively and professionally
  • Build relationships with customers and encourage return visits
  • Plan and support community engagement events (e.g., book signings, reading sessions)

Main Requirements:

  • 8+ years of retail management experience, ideally in bookstores, lifestyle, or F&B
  • Experience managing stores with 1,500+ sqm floor space
  • Strong leadership, multitasking, and organizational skills
  • Comfortable with PDCA practices for process improvement
  • Financial acumen and proficiency in POS, inventory systems, and MS Office
  • Fluent in English; Japanese or other languages a plus
  • Passion for books, community spaces, and café culture

Working Conditions

  • Full-time, hands-on role on the sales floor

  • Willing to work weekends and holidays as needed

  • Open to other duties as assigned by management
